Olympic wrestler Adeline Gray will not be in the running for the world championships team this year because of surgeries in January to repair a shoulder and a knee. Gray, a three-time world champion who graduated from Bear Creek High School, injured a shoulder a month before the Rio Olympics where she was favored to win the gold medal but went out in the quarterfinals.
